Course Overview

This comprehensive Hairdressing course equips learners with professional skills in hair cutting, styling, coloring, and treatment. Designed for individuals passionate about the beauty industry, the program provides hands-on training in modern salon techniques, customer service, hygiene, and product knowledge. Participants gain experience in client consultation, scalp care, braiding, and equipment handling, enabling them to work in salons or launch their own hairdressing businesses.

Course Content

Module 1: Hair Science & Scalp Care

  • Hair anatomy and structure
  • Scalp analysis and treatments
  • Hair conditions and care solutions

Module 3: Hair Cutting Techniques

  • Basic and advanced cutting
  • Blunt, layered, and textured cuts
  • Children and men's haircuts

Module 5: Braiding and Weaving

  • Types of braids
  • Weave installation
  • Hair extensions

Module 7: Customer Service & Hygiene

  • Client consultation
  • Salon hygiene practices
  • Professional ethics

Module 2: Shampooing & Conditioning

  • Hair washing techniques
  • Scalp massage
  • Product selection and application

Module 4: Hair Styling & Finishing

  • Blow drying and curling
  • Updos and bridal styles
  • Styling tools and products

Module 6: Hair Coloring Techniques

  • Permanent, semi-permanent color
  • Highlighting and bleaching
  • Color correction basics

Module 8: Entrepreneurship in Hairdressing

  • Salon setup and branding
  • Client retention
  • Business operations
